  • Abstract
    Monolithic cascade solar cells offer an extremely promising method for high-efficiency photovoltaic energy conversion. Low-resistance electrical connection of the individual sub-cells is essential. Such electrical connection has been one of the major obstacles to the demonstration of high-efficiency monolithic multijunction cells.
